Mgt 3304- chapter 6: strategic management: strategic positioning and its principles, strategic positioning- attempts to achieve sustainable competitive advantage by preserving what is distinctive about a company, key principles, 1. Strategy is the creation of a unique and valuable position: few needs, many customers, broad needs, few customers, broad needs, many customers, 2. Strategy involves creating a fit among activities: fit has to do with the ways a company"s activities interact and reinforce one another, five steps of the strategic management process, 1. Establish the mission and the vision: 2. Assess the current reality: current reality assessment- look at where the organization stands and see what is working and what could be different so as to maximize efficiency and effectiveness in achieving the organization"s mission, 3. Formulate the grand strategy: grand strategy- explains how the organization"s mission is to be accomplished.
